JNCryptor语言 - RNCryptor Image 文件加密/解密



我正在尝试使用 RNCryptor 库的 AES256 实现进行图像加密/解密。

这是我到目前为止的代码:

//Encrypt file
/**
 *
var encryptedData = RNCryptor.encrypt(data: data as Data, withPassword: hashKey.description)
try encryptedData.write(to: fileURL)
 * */
fun encryptFile( inputFile : File ) : File {
    val size = inputFile.length().toInt()
    val fileBytes = ByteArray(size)
    val aeS256JNCryptor = AES256JNCryptor()
    val file = File(Environment.getExternalStorageDirectory().toString() + "/Encrypted_" + inputFile.name)
    try {
        val buf = BufferedInputStream(FileInputStream(inputFile))
        buf.read(fileBytes, 0, fileBytes.size)
        val encryptedFileBytes = aeS256JNCryptor.encryptData(fileBytes, "master".toCharArray())
        val bufOut = BufferedOutputStream(FileOutputStream(file))
        bufOut.write(encryptedFileBytes)
        buf.close()
        bufOut.close()
    } catch (e: FileNotFoundException) {
        // TODO Auto-generated catch block
        e.printStackTrace()
    } catch (e: IOException) {
        // TODO Auto-generated catch block
        e.printStackTrace()
    }
    return file
}
//Decrypt file
/**
 *
let encryptedData = fileManager.contents(atPath: filePathNormal)
let decryptedData = try RNCryptor.decrypt(data: encryptedData!, withPassword: hashKey.description)
let selected_image = UIImage.sd_image(with: decryptedData)
 * */
fun decryptFile( inputFile : File ) : File {
    val size = inputFile.length().toInt()
    val fileBytes = ByteArray(size)
    val aeS256JNCryptor = AES256JNCryptor()
    val file = File(Environment.getExternalStorageDirectory().toString() + "/Decrypted_" + inputFile.name)
    try {
        val buf = BufferedInputStream(FileInputStream(inputFile))
        buf.read(fileBytes, 0, fileBytes.size)
        val decryptedFileBytes = aeS256JNCryptor.decryptData(fileBytes, "master".toCharArray())
        val bufOut = BufferedOutputStream(file.outputStream())
        bufOut.write(decryptedFileBytes)
        buf.close()
        bufOut.close()
    } catch (e: FileNotFoundException) {
        // TODO Auto-generated catch block
        e.printStackTrace()
    } catch (e: IOException) {
        // TODO Auto-generated catch block
        e.printStackTrace()
    }
    return file
}

解密后,我无法加载/查看图像。我已经发布了评论中使用的相关iOS代码。如果我在某处出错,请告诉我。

通过更改密码的加密和使用方式来解决。

这是有效的:

//Encrypt file
/**
 *
var encryptedData = RNCryptor.encrypt(data: data as Data, withPassword: hashKey.description)
try encryptedData.write(to: fileURL)
 fileBytes - 3,1,-54,106
 encrypted - 3,1,71,68
 * */
fun encryptFile( inputFile : File, privateKey : CharArray ) : File {
    val size = inputFile.length().toInt()
    val fileBytes = ByteArray(size)
    val aeS256JNCryptor = AES256JNCryptor()
    val file = File(Environment.getExternalStorageDirectory().toString() + "/Encrypted_" + inputFile.name)
    try {
        val buf = BufferedInputStream(FileInputStream(inputFile))
        buf.read(fileBytes, 0, fileBytes.size)
        val encryptedFileBytes = aeS256JNCryptor.encryptData(fileBytes, privateKey)
        val bufOut = BufferedOutputStream(FileOutputStream(file))
        bufOut.write(encryptedFileBytes)
        buf.close()
        bufOut.close()
    } catch (e: FileNotFoundException) {
        // TODO Auto-generated catch block
        e.printStackTrace()
    } catch (e: IOException) {
        // TODO Auto-generated catch block
        e.printStackTrace()
    }
    return file
}
//Decrypt file
/**
 *
let encryptedData = fileManager.contents(atPath: filePathNormal)
let decryptedData = try RNCryptor.decrypt(data: encryptedData!, withPassword: hashKey.description)
let selected_image = UIImage.sd_image(with: decryptedData)
encrypted - 3,1,71,68
decrypted Bytes - 3,1,-54,106
 * */
fun decryptFile( inputFile : File, privateKey: CharArray ) : File {
    val size = inputFile.length().toInt()
    val fileBytes = ByteArray(size)
    val aeS256JNCryptor = AES256JNCryptor()
    val file = File(Environment.getExternalStorageDirectory().toString() + "/Decrypted_" + inputFile.name)
    try {
        val buf = BufferedInputStream(FileInputStream(inputFile))
        buf.read(fileBytes, 0, fileBytes.size)
        val decryptedFileBytes = aeS256JNCryptor.decryptData(fileBytes, privateKey)
        if( file.exists() ) file.delete()
        val fileOutputStream = FileOutputStream( file.absolutePath )
        fileOutputStream.write(decryptedFileBytes)
        buf.close()
        fileOutputStream.close()
    } catch (e: FileNotFoundException) {
        // TODO Auto-generated catch block
        e.printStackTrace()
    } catch (e: IOException) {
        // TODO Auto-generated catch block
        e.printStackTrace()
    }
    return file
}

私钥是一个长度为 16 的随机字母数字字符串。一旦生成,它 在加密和解密文件时需要重复使用。
